Ticket: Idempotency keys disabled on Pellorin staging

During review of the payment-retry branch, I noticed staging has IDEMPOTENCY_MODE set to "off", so retried charges on Pellorin are not deduplicated. This masks the exact bug the branch fixes. I've corrected the mode to "strict" and set the key TTL to 24 hours. The key-store connection also requires authentication, so the env file gains the line below.

sealed setting: RELAY_SECRET5=82864

- [ ] **Step 7: Breaker override escrow.** After sealing the signing keys for the Tallgrove upstream API circuit breaker, confirm the support team can force the breaker open during a full outage. The override bundle lives in the sealed escrow drawer and is useless without its unlock phrase. Two ceremony witnesses must initial this step before proceeding. The escrow bundle is decrypted with the recovery passphrase that follows.

vault phrase of kahip-kahop = holath-quenmir

## Account Recovery — Trailnote Offline Mode

When a surveyor's Trailnote app has been offline for 30+ days, their local credentials expire and sync refuses to resume. Don't make them wipe the device — all their unsynced field data lives there! Instead, open the support console, pick "Offline Reinstate," and enter their handle. The console will ask for the support team's shared recovery passphrase before issuing a reinstatement token. Use the one below.

unlock words, bagaf-fajeg: zorael-kelax-fraath-quenix-eliok-sileth-aldmir-wenir-druiel

## Escalation Contacts — Fernwheel Transcoding Farm

If a transcode node in the Fernwheel farm stalls or the queue depth exceeds the documented threshold, first check the node health dashboard and attempt one drain-and-restart cycle. Do not reboot more than two nodes simultaneously, as this risks cascading re-queues. If the issue persists beyond fifteen minutes, or involves corrupted output files, escalate to the Media Infrastructure team at Quillbrook Systems. Their escalation inbox is monitored around the clock and should be your next step.

billing contact of yawip-yadup = druath.casdor@nelvrolabs.internal